The ins-and-outs of Open Access Publishing Online
Are you interested in making your scholarship more accessible to scholars around the world? This workshop will explore the ins-and-outs of open access, the publishing model that makes research information electronically available to readers at no cost. Participants will learn the basics of open access, how to make their research available open access, and how to avoid predatory publishers and journals.
This workshop is part of the UAB Libraries’ Office of Scholarly Communication series.
